Kliq Week coming next week on the network to co inside with the release of The Kliq DVD/BluRay

Yep, we are getting a first look at the Kliq set after Raw on Monday, the reunion special that was speculated to be on the Bluray when it was first announced called The Kliq Behind the Curtain on Tuesday, a 90 minute match and moments compilation on Wednesday and a 30 minute documentary on Big Kev that looks similar to the Bryan, Reigns and Warrior ones on Thursday

Heatwave 98 is considered ECW's best PPV, Anarchy Rulz 99 is also very good.

 

On the WCW side of things, Starrcade 97 is their most successful PPV and culminated the year long build of Hollywood Hogan v Sting. Whatever you do, avoid Uncensored 96 unless your some kind of masochist

As for WCW a surprisingly decent show is a Spring Stampede 1999. I'm a sucker for WCW though so I find enjoyment in most of their shows, so maybe just watching a random WCW PPV you may see something you like. A lot of the time the wrestling is pretty good, just some of the storylines are completely unexplainable. WCW Halloween Havoc 1998 had the potential to be one of their best shows ever but turned out to be a massive disappointment, a double main event of Ultimate Warrior against Hogan and Sting versus Bret Hart should have been great but in typical WCW fashion it really wasn't.

Still no sign of any more WCW Monday Nitro being added (it still only goes up to the end of 1996), but there has been a lot of Raw from 1997 added recently. There are still episodes to be added but if your watching in order you can make it upto #201 which has Bret v Sid for the title in the cage on the go home episode before Wrestlemania 13, featuring Bret's awesome post match rant and Sid's "I don't know shit, crybaby!" line

The content from The Kliq DVD release they've put up recently is brilliant, some fantastic backstage footage but in particular the bit about BSK where Charles Wright explains the origin and meaning of the name is something I got a huge kick out of. This bit also includes some of the first (if not the first) WWE sanctioned footage of the Undertaker backstage and 'out of character' while in the 'Deadman' gimmick. Other than a handful of missing episodes (303, 234, 229, 224, 205 - all soon to be added I'm sure) the first 311 episodes of Raw are on there now, going into May 1999.

 

Although episode 141 is still missing, so for one reason or another may never get added.
